MySQL第三方连接工具科普
MySQL 是一个广泛使用的关系数据库管理系统(RDBMS),经常被用于各种应用程序中。为了更高效地进行数据库操作,开发者和数据库管理员通常使用第三方连接工具。本文将介绍一些常用的 MySQL 第三方连接工具,并提供代码示例以帮助您更好地理解如何使用它们。我们还将通过旅行图和饼状图的方式来展示这些工具的特点与应用场景。
MySQL数据库管理的常用工具
在与MySQL数据库进行交互的过程中,常见的第三方连接工具包括:
- MySQL Workbench
- DBeaver
- HeidiSQL
- Navicat
- DataGrip
每种工具都有其独特之处,接下来我们将逐一探讨,并配合代码示例进行说明。
1. MySQL Workbench
MySQL Workbench 是官方提供的一个综合管理工具,适合数据库设计、建模、SQL开发和管理等多种功能。以下是使用 Workbench 连接到 MySQL 数据库的示例代码。
CREATE TABLE users (
id INT AUTO_INCREMENT PRIMARY KEY,
username VARCHAR(255) NOT NULL,
password VARCHAR(255) NOT NULL
);
2. DBeaver
DBeaver 是一个通用的数据库管理工具,支持多种数据库,包括 MySQL。DBeaver 提供了一个用户友好的界面,可以方便地进行数据库操作。以下是如何使用 DBeaver 执行查询的示例:
SELECT * FROM users WHERE username = 'testuser';
3. HeidiSQL
HeidiSQL 是一款轻量级的数据库管理工具,界面简洁,操作方便,非常适合初学者。使用 HeidiSQL 可以快速进行数据库的 CRUD 操作。
INSERT INTO users (username, password) VALUES ('newuser', 'securepassword');
4. Navicat
Navicat 是一款收费的数据库管理工具,但其强大的功能和优雅的界面让许多开发者乐此不疲。使用 Navicat 连接到 MySQL 数据库,可以快速进行管理与备份。
UPDATE users SET password = 'newpassword' WHERE username = 'testuser';
5. DataGrip
DataGrip 是 JetBrains 提供的一款数据库 IDE,功能强大,支持多种数据库。其智能的 SQL 编辑器非常适合需要复杂查询的开发者。
DELETE FROM users WHERE id = 1;
如何选择合适的连接工具
在选择合适的 MySQL 连接工具时,您可能需要考虑以下几个因素:
- 功能需求:您需要的数据管理、建模和开发功能
- 用户体验:工具的易用性及界面友好程度
- 支持情况:对各类数据库的支持及更新频率
- 预算:您的预算范围,是否适合选择收费工具
使用旅行图展示工具的使用过程
journey
title MySQL 第三方连接工具使用过程
section 选择合适的工具
了解需求: 5: 用户
调研可用工具: 4: 用户
比较工具优缺点: 3: 用户
section 下载安装
下载工具: 5: 用户
按照说明安装: 4: 用户
section 连接数据库
输入数据库信息: 5: 用户
测试连接成功: 5: 用户
数据库管理工具的使用统计
接下来,我们使用饼状图展示各个工具在开发者中使用的比例。
pie
title 数据库管理工具使用情况
"MySQL Workbench": 30
"DBeaver": 25
"HeidiSQL": 15
"Navicat": 20
"DataGrip": 10
总结
上述介绍了一些常见的 MySQL 第三方连接工具,包括 MySQL Workbench、DBeaver、HeidiSQL、Navicat 和 DataGrip,每种工具都有其特点和适用场景。通过合理地选择和使用这些工具,开发者能够提升工作效率,更加专注于业务逻辑的实现。
在选择工具时,建议根据自己的需求和预算进行充分对比,确保能够找到最合适的工具进行数据库管理。虽然有些工具需要付费,但通常它们提供的功能会远超免费工具,能够帮助用户节省大量的时间和精力。
希望本文对你们理解 MySQL 第三方连接工具有所帮助,启发你们在日后的工作中找到适合自己的工具,以提高效率和工作质量。